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


43263 / 76735 ←次へ | 前へ→

【38522】Re:配列を使用し変数をセルに代入
回答  Kein  - 06/6/5(月) 18:02 -

引用なし
パスワード
   >a〜gまでの7種類の変数に格納
それは配列変数ではありませんね。
>あるテキストデータを1行ごとに分割
例えば

Dim FSO As Object
Dim Ary As Variant
Dim AllSt As String
Const MyF As String = "C:\temp\Test.txt"

Set FSO = CreateObject("Scripting.FileSystemObject")
With FSO.OpenTextFile(MyF, 1)
  AllSt = .ReadAll
  .Close
End With
Ary = Split(AllSt, vbCrLf)
If Ubound(Ary) < 257 Then
  Cells(1, 1).Resize(, UBound(Ary) + 1).Value = Ary
Else
  MsgBox "シートの列数に収まりません", 48
End If
Set FSO = Nothing: Erase Ary

などとすれば、1行分の文字列を一つのセルに入力する作業を、
全文一括して行えますが。

0 hits

【38519】配列を使用し変数をセルに代入 roxy 06/6/5(月) 17:36 質問
【38522】Re:配列を使用し変数をセルに代入 Kein 06/6/5(月) 18:02 回答
【38523】Re:配列を使用し変数をセルに代入 roxy 06/6/5(月) 18:06 発言
【38525】Re:配列を使用し変数をセルに代入 Kein 06/6/5(月) 18:24 発言
【38536】Re:配列を使用し変数をセルに代入 roxy 06/6/6(火) 9:50 発言
【38539】Re:配列を使用し変数をセルに代入 Jaka 06/6/6(火) 10:40 発言

43263 / 76735 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free